Judit and leave her servant BethuliëJudit and Holofernes (series title) Property Type: Serial picture: 3 / 8Objectnummer: RP-P-OB-7310Catalogusreferentie: Hollstein Dutch 60-2 (2) New Hollstein Dutch 201-2 ( 2) Note: Heemskerckstraat Description: Judit leaves Bethulia with her maid. They pray to God. In the background she is captured by the Assyrian army and brought to Holofernes. The print is part of an eight-part series that tells the story of Judith and Holofernes. Manufacturer : printmaker: Dirck Volckertsz. Coornhert (attributed to) to drawing of: Maarten van Heemskerck (attributed to) Place manufacture: Haarlem Dating: ca. 1547 - ca. 1559 Physical characteristics: etching material: paper Technique: etching dimensions: sheet: b 195 mm × H 235 mm Subject: Judith and her maidservant take leave of the elsewhere at the city gate judith and her maidservant are led to Holofernes' tent
